Heim  >  Artikel  >  Web-Frontend  >  Zusammenfassung und gemeinsame Nutzung von Leerzeichen-Entitäten in HTML

Zusammenfassung und gemeinsame Nutzung von Leerzeichen-Entitäten in HTML

黄舟
黄舟Original
2017-05-27 14:54:222349Durchsuche

Zusammenfassung:

Browser kürzen Leerzeichen in HTML-Seiten immer ab. Wenn Sie 10 Leerzeichen in Ihren Text schreiben, entfernt der Browser 9 davon, bevor die Seite angezeigt wird. Um die Anzahl der Leerzeichen auf der Seite zu erhöhen, müssen Sie die Zeichenentität verwenden.

Dieser Artikel stellt nur die Zeichenentität von Leerzeichen vor. HTML bietet 6 Arten von Leerzeichenentitäten:

 
 
 
 
‌
‍

auf der Webseite, im Allgemeinen gibt es 3 Schreibweisen:

1. 直接输入法输入例如“版权” – ©.
2. 字符:©
3. charCode:©

Text:

nicht umbrechendeLeerzeichen) Kodierung : In HTML, es wird durch Drücken der Leertaste generiert (wird nur als 1 gezählt). Sie müssen durch HTML-Entitäten dargestellt werden, um akkumuliert zu werden.  

 

Em-Leerzeichen-Zeichenkodierung<a href="http://www.php.cn/code/3792.html" target="_blank ">002<p>;</p></a>: em ist die Maßeinheit der &#x2<a href="http://www.php.cn/code/3792.html" target="_blank">002</a>;Typografie. Dies entspricht der aktuell angegebenen Punktnummer. Beispielsweise ist 1em in einer 16-Pixel-Schriftart 16 Pixel. Dieser Raum verfügt über eine sehr robuste Funktion. Die von eingenommene Breite beträgt genau 1 chinesische Breite .

&ensp;

Zeichenkodierung mit halber Breite (En Space)

: en ist die Maßeinheit für Typografie. Es ist halb so breit wie em. Beispielsweise beträgt 1en 16 Pixel in einer 16-Pixel-Schriftart, was nominell der Breite des Kleinbuchstabens n entspricht. Dieser Raum verfügt über eine sehr robuste Funktion. Die von &#x2003; eingenommene Breite beträgt genau die Hälfte der chinesischen Breite .

&thinsp;

Thin Space nimmt eine geringere Breite ein, es ist ein Sechstel eines Gevierts breit.

&zwnj;

Null

Breite Non Joiner) Zeichenkodierung : kurz „ZWNJ“, ist ein nicht druckbares Zeichen zwischen zwei Zeichen Text wird die sonst auftretende Silbentrennung unterdrückt und stattdessen die ursprünglichen Glyphen der beiden Zeichen gezeichnet. HTML-Zeichenwert &#x200C. &#8204;

&zwj;

Zero-Width-Joiner-Zeichenkodierung

: „ZWJ“ kurz, ist ein nicht druckbares Zeichen, das in einigen Sprachen verwendet wird, die einen komplexen Schriftsatz erfordern ( z. B B. Arabisch, Hindi) zwischen zwei Zeichen, was dazu führt, dass die beiden Zeichen, die nicht getrennt worden wären, einen Silbentrennungseffekt erzeugen. HTML-Zeichenwert &#x200D. &#8205;

Andere:

  • Der Browser analysiert auch die folgenden Zeichen als Leerzeichen: Leerzeichen

    , Tabstopp &#x0020;, Zeilenvorschub &#x0009;, Wagenrücklauf &#x000A; und &#x000D; usw. &#12288;

  • bedeutet numerische Zeichenreferenzen&#x+16进制/十进制

  • bedeutet Zeichenentitätsreferenzen, der Name der HTML-Zeichenentität muss in HTML enthalten sein Es können nur diejenigen verwendet werden, die in definiert wurden. &+实体名

  • Der Vorteil der Verwendung von Entitätsnamen anstelle von Zahlen besteht darin, dass die Namen leichter zu merken sind. Der Nachteil besteht darin, dass Browser möglicherweise nicht alle Entitätsnamen unterstützen (die Unterstützung für Entitätsnummern ist gut).

  • Entitätsnamen unterscheiden zwischen Groß- und Kleinschreibung.

Das obige ist der detaillierte Inhalt vonZusammenfassung und gemeinsame Nutzung von Leerzeichen-Entitäten in HTML.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n